Why Is My Snake Plant Dying? How to Revive It

Snake plants are popular indoor choices, known for their resilience and low-maintenance nature. Despite their hardiness, they can show signs of distress. Understanding these factors helps identify issues and aid recovery.

Overwatering and Root Rot

Overwatering frequently causes decline and root rot in snake plants. Symptoms include mushy, soft, or squishy leaves, often yellowing or browning, and a foul odor from the soil. This happens because excessive moisture deprives roots of oxygen, leading to decay.

To address overwatering, immediately cease watering and allow the soil to dry out completely. If root rot is suspected, carefully remove the plant from its pot to inspect the roots. Healthy snake plant roots are firm and white, while rotted roots appear brown, black, slimy, or mushy. Trim away all affected, decaying roots using clean, sterilized scissors, and remove any heavily damaged leaves.

Repot the plant in fresh, well-draining soil, ideally a succulent or cactus mix, ensuring the new pot has adequate drainage holes. Do not reuse the old soil, as it may harbor harmful pathogens. After repotting, avoid watering for several days to allow the plant to acclimate and the roots to heal. Water only when the soil is completely dry, which can be every few weeks, and less frequently during winter.

Underwatering and Dehydration

Insufficient water can also cause decline, though less common than overwatering. Signs include wrinkled, shriveled, or curled leaves. Leaf edges may become dry, crispy, and brown. Stunted growth also indicates underwatering.

If the soil is extremely dry and compacted, the plant is likely dehydrated. To revive an underwatered snake plant, provide a thorough, deep watering. This can involve placing the pot in a container of lukewarm water for 15-20 minutes to allow the soil to absorb moisture from the bottom up. Ensure all excess water drains away afterward.

The plant should show signs of perking up within an hour if dehydration is mild. For severely dehydrated plants, new growth may appear within a couple of weeks. Continue to monitor the soil and water only when it has fully dried out, striking a balance to prevent future issues.

Light-Related Stress

Snake plants adapt to various light conditions but can suffer from too little or too much. In low light, leaves may become pale, leggy, or stretch, leading to weak growth; variegated types might lose patterns. Though they survive in low light, more light promotes better growth.

Conversely, excessive direct sunlight can cause damage, leading to bleached or scorched spots on leaves. The foliage might appear faded, and crispy leaf edges can develop. This kind of damage is permanent and will not heal.

The optimal condition for snake plants is bright, indirect light. Placing them near an east- or west-facing window, or using sheer curtains to diffuse intense light, provides suitable illumination. If a plant is showing light stress, adjust its placement gradually to avoid shocking it.

Temperature Extremes

Snake plants prefer stable, warm temperatures; extreme fluctuations cause stress. They thrive in daytime temperatures of 70-90°F (21-32°C) and nighttime temperatures of 60-70°F (15-21°C). Temperatures below 50°F (10°C) are harmful, risking leaf damage, wilting, or root rot. Freezing conditions (32°F or 0°C) cause irreversible frost damage.

Cold damage symptoms include mushy, soft leaves, yellowing, drooping, curling foliage, and brown spots. Conversely, prolonged exposure to temperatures above 85°F (29°C) can also stress the plant, leading to wilting or increased water loss.

To prevent temperature stress, maintain a consistent room temperature and keep snake plants away from cold drafts from windows or air conditioners. Protect them from direct heat sources like radiators or heating vents. Moving the plant to a warmer spot and pruning damaged areas can help it recover from cold exposure.

Pests and Diseases

Snake plants are generally resistant to pests and diseases, but can be affected. Common pests include spider mites, mealybugs, and fungus gnats. Spider mites cause stippling and webbing, mealybugs appear as white masses, and fungus gnats are tiny flying insects often found in moist soil.

Beyond root rot, snake plants can experience other fungal issues. Leaf spot diseases manifest as dark spots or patches on foliage. Powdery mildew appears as a white, powdery coating on leaves. These fungal problems often thrive in high humidity and poor air circulation.

Regularly inspecting the plant for signs of pests or disease is important for early detection. For pests, solutions include wiping leaves with a damp cloth, using insecticidal soap, or applying neem oil. Improving air circulation and ensuring proper watering can help prevent fungal infections. If fungal issues persist, a fungicide may be considered.
